Members of government forces wounded in Syria’s Daraa
DARAA, Syria (North Press) – A number of the government forces’ members were wounded on Monday in an attack on their military vehicle in the eastern countryside of Daraa.
“About five members of the government forces were wounded in an attack on their military vehicle carried out by unidentified gunmen on the Izraa- Namer Highway, east of Daraa,” a local source told North Press.
“Ambulances arrived at the site of the incident and transported the wounded al-Sanamayn City Hospital, north of Daraa,” the source added.
The area witnessed intense security deployment of members of the security branches of the government forces who began searching for the perpetrators, according to the source.
In recent months, Daraa governorate has witnessed several similar incidents, the most prominent of which was the killing of Major Maher Wassouf, who was affiliated with the Political Security Branch of the government forces, in an attack by unknown assailants on his car near the town of Sayda in the eastern countryside of Daraa.
